Charlie Lamdin

House prices will fall a record-breaking 35% peak to trough, over however long that takes, likely two-three years, property commentator Charlie Lamdin has warned.

The claim from Lamdin, founder of Best Agent and presenter of the Moving Home with Charlie YouTube and TikTok channels, will frighten many homeowners who face seeing the value of their property plunge. It will also annoy many estate agents.

Those tasked with selling property may also be irritated by Lamdin’s recent piece published in the Sunday Times urging people to hold off from buying property, unless purchasing at a hefty discount.

Interviewer Chris Watkin describes Lamdin as “a marmite kind of guy in estate agency circles”, but is he actually an industry maverick or a clickbait doom-monger?
